Dmmetler Posted October 4, 2010 Share Posted October 4, 2010 I like Ana Lomba's CD, Hop Jump and Sing Spanish. It's folk songs/games completely in Spanish, but with a separate track introducing the vocabulary. Matryoshka Posted October 4, 2010 Share Posted October 4, 2010 José Luis Orozco has fantastic CDs, and they all have songbooks with the lyrics in Spanish and English (the CDs are in Spanish only). He has CDs with games and fingerplays, songs about holidays, and a CD with alphabet, numbers, days of week/month, etc.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
